Educate Yourself Guitar And Save Money At The Same Time

By Hugh Magnus


Expert music lessons could add up to a big expense quickly. When you teach your self guitar then you learn how to play an instrument and save cash at the same time. The cost is an important aspect but it isn't the most important consideration if you want to learn to play this musical instrument. The greatest factor is how easy the lessons are to follow and how well the education received is retained. Many sites provide lessons which build on each other for guitar understanding which is more complete.

Many people don't have limitless finances or large financial resources to spend just to understand how to play the guitar. On-line lessons could be very reasonable, and can be located for as little as $1-$2 in some cases. Other plans might cost more but the value is still very economical in comparison with the expense of a music tutor or taking a music class at a college.

An instant on-line search will show ways that you can educate your self guitar and see considerable savings on the cost. Lesson plans vary from very basic beginning concepts to sophisticated musical pieces that require several hours of practice to perfect. It's possible to become an exceptional guitarist with out ever having a single professional lesson. The results achieved will depend on the quantity of time and the effort that is expended to understand the guitar thoroughly.

Several Americans are experiencing tough economic times and learning to play the guitar with out professional support can be very cost effective and a smart way to entertain. Whether the objective is just to enjoy yourself or to entertain others this could be achieved in a very short time in some cases. Many websites offer a number of free lessons just before there's a price involved.

Whether instructional manuals, online lessons, or even borrowed library books are utilized make sure that each practice and learning program includes materials that are appropriate for your level of skill. Trying to handle advanced ideas and pieces before learning the fundamentals can result in frustration and affect your ability to learn efficiently.
